var exp = new RegExp(pattern,modifier) //pattern為正則的條件或者是字符串; modifier為修飾符 g : 表示全局匹配;i:忽略大小寫;m:忽略大小寫;^:以什么開頭;$:以什么結尾 var exp = new RegExp("h",g ...
var reg d 錯誤格式,這是一個字符串var reg d 正確格式 reg .test scope.message.plateNumber 這時會報錯 reg.test is not a function 解決辦法: new RegExp reg 將字符串格式轉化為正則表達式 ...
2017-05-26 10:01 0 1329 推薦指數:
var exp = new RegExp(pattern,modifier) //pattern為正則的條件或者是字符串; modifier為修飾符 g : 表示全局匹配;i:忽略大小寫;m:忽略大小寫;^:以什么開頭;$:以什么結尾 var exp = new RegExp("h",g ...
正則表達式 test 踩坑指南 test 只能使用一次,第二次返回的是錯誤結果!❌ RegExp.prototype.test() https://developer.mozilla.org/en-US/docs/Web/JavaScript/Reference ...
test() 方法是正則表達式的一個方法,用於檢測一個字符串是否匹配某個模式.test 方法檢查字符串是否與給出的正則表達式模式相匹配,如果是則返回 true,否則就返回 false。每個正則表達式都有一個 lastIndex 屬性,用於記錄上一次匹配結束的位置.語法:regexp.test ...
1. 創建正則表達式字面量,加上^和$,與不加是有區別的(對於test方法,存在比正則多的字符的時候,依然返回比較成功true,這與我們僅僅想比較內容符合預期的要求是相背離的。比如:var regx = /\d{1,2}\/\d{1,2}\/\d{4}/gi; regx.test('08/08 ...
1.正則表達式:記錄文本的規則的代碼 \b:元字符,單詞分界處,匹配一個位置 .:元字符,匹配出了除了換行符以外的任意字符 *:元字符,指定*前邊的內容可以連續重復以使整個表達式得到匹配 \d:元字符,匹配一位數字 \s:匹配任意的空白字符,如空格,制表符,換行符,中文全角空格 \w ...
日常工作中,總會遇到正則的時候,索性就把它 搞清楚。后來才發現正則很好用,完全可以替代split和repleace的那種需要循環遍歷時的無賴。 簡單表達式 最簡單的正則表達式大家都已熟悉,即文字字符串。特定的字符串可通過文字本身加以描述;像 foo 這樣的正則表達式模式可精確匹配輸入的字符串 ...
1 簡介/動機 正則表達式 :為高級的文本模式匹配、抽取、與/或文本形式的搜索和替換功能提供了基礎。 Python 通過標准的re模塊來支持正則表達式。 注意:此處我們提到的搜索和匹配意義不一樣 你的第一個正則表達式 正則表達式 匹配的字符串 ...
地獄-天堂之說,源自老程序員的話.老程序員告訴我們,沒有正則表達式就像地獄一般,有了正則表達式我們就像進了天堂一樣.好,我們下面看這么幾個需求: 需求1:“192.168.10.5[port=8080]”,這個字符串表示IP地址為192.168.10.5的服務器的8080端口是打開的,請用 ...